rss2hook
Lightweight personal RSS aggregator and reader
rss2hook is a small self-hosted service that monitors a list of RSS feeds and triggers webhooks whenever new items appear. It is useful for routing feed updates into other systems and automations.
Key features
- Monitors RSS feeds
- Triggers webhooks on new items
- Single-binary tool
- Simple configuration
Strengths
- Released under the MIT license
- Easy to set up — beginner-friendly
- Written in Go
- Tiny footprint — runs in 64 MB RAM
